This episode of the Danger Gnome Podcast is sort of a three-act, variety show that blends a little bit of the Ask the Bicycle Doctor with the Black Ribbon Radio Hour all wrapped together with Danger Gnome gaffers tape. I chat with Jeff Davis about gear recommendations for an upcoming 40K fat-bike ride at the Stanley Winterfest. Then I talk with Erik Olson, General Manager of Portland Design Works about the legend behind Mudshovel fat-bike fenders and the Show wraps up with a Danger Gnome After Hours segment with our Fatbassador to Alaska, Travis Hubbard. Travis shares his thoughts about his new Akio from Corvus Cycles and of course, we both meander off into the weeds on a whole variety of subjects like wheel-size, racks, and gnomes.
